What to Do Right Now
Step 1: Check for injuries and get safe. If your car is drivable, pull into one of the parking lots along Riverside Drive. Turn on your hazards. Check yourself and your passengers for injuries. Neck pain, headache, dizziness, and confusion are all potential signs of whiplash or concussion.
Step 2: Call the police. LAPD North Hollywood Division handles collision reports on Riverside Drive and other Toluca Lake streets. Call 911 or the non-emergency line to get officers to the scene. A police report is essential for your insurance claim and any legal action. Do not let the other driver talk you out of calling. Even if they seem apologetic and cooperative now, their insurance company will not be.
Step 3: Document everything at the scene. Take photos of both vehicles from every angle, including the license plates, all points of damage, the road conditions, and the intersection. Photograph traffic signals, stop signs, and any skid marks. Get the other driver's name, insurance information, and phone number. If there are witnesses, people walking along the village area, other drivers, workers at nearby businesses, get their names and numbers. They will be hard to find later.
Step 4: Preserve business camera footage. The Riverside Drive village has businesses on both sides of the street, many with exterior security cameras. These cameras may have captured the crash, including the other driver's speed and whether they were looking at their phone. But this footage gets overwritten quickly, typically within 48 to 72 hours. Note the specific businesses nearest to where the crash happened so your attorney can send preservation letters immediately.
Step 5: Get medical attention today. Go to Providence Saint Joseph Medical Center in Burbank. It is the closest major hospital to Toluca Lake and has a full emergency department. Even if you feel mostly okay, get evaluated. Whiplash is the signature injury of rear-end crashes, and it does not always present symptoms immediately. The adrenaline coursing through your body right now is masking pain. A same-day medical record connecting your injuries to this crash is the most important piece of evidence you will have.
Step 6: Do not give a recorded statement to the other driver's insurer. They will call, probably tomorrow. They will be polite. They will ask how you are feeling and what happened. Do not engage beyond confirming the date and your police report number. Direct them to your attorney.
Why Rear-End Crashes on Riverside Drive Cause Serious Injuries
Rear-end collisions at even moderate speeds create a whiplash mechanism, your body is pushed forward by the seat while your head stays in place for a fraction of a second, then snaps backward. The forces are concentrated in your cervical spine. Herniated discs, muscle strains, ligament damage, and concussions are all common results.
What makes Riverside Drive rear-end crashes particularly deceptive is that traffic speeds here are moderate, 25 to 35 mph, so people assume the injuries must be minor. That assumption is wrong. Low-speed rear-end impacts produce some of the most persistent soft-tissue injuries because the vehicle's crumple zones absorb less force at lower speeds, transferring more energy to the occupants.
If you are dealing with neck pain, back stiffness, headaches, or difficulty concentrating days after a rear-end crash on Riverside Drive, those symptoms are consistent with the mechanics of the crash and need to be documented by your doctor.
Your Liability Position Is Strong
California law places a strong presumption of fault on the following driver in a rear-end collision. The trailing driver has a legal duty to maintain a safe following distance and be prepared to stop. If someone hit you from behind on Riverside Drive, the liability picture is almost always in your favor.
The other driver may argue that you stopped suddenly, that you braked for no reason, or that you were partially at fault. These defenses rarely succeed without strong evidence to support them. The default position in California is that if you hit someone from behind, you were following too closely, driving too fast, or not paying attention.

What Compensation You Can Recover
Rear-end crash victims in Toluca Lake can recover medical expenses (emergency care at Providence Saint Joseph, imaging, physical therapy, specialist visits), lost wages from missed work, pain and suffering from the physical and emotional impact of the injuries, and property damage to the vehicle.
Soft-tissue injury cases from rear-end crashes with documented treatment and lost work typically settle in the $30,000 to $120,000 range. Cases involving disc herniations, injections, or longer rehabilitation periods go higher. The value depends on the severity of your injuries, the quality of your medical documentation, and the at-fault driver's insurance limits.
